description The aim of this paper is to introduce a robust methodology for the analytical calculation of acceleration by shock of a rigid body with a rubber buffer. It consists of two stages. At first it is necessary to determine some mechanical properties of the viscoelastic material (rubber) by quasistatic tests. The second stage includes shock testing of a rubber buffer and modeling this process with a theoretical model. The proposed methodology provides good accuracy by comparison of the received experimental and theoretical results.
